TITLE 19 - EDUCATION
PART 7 - STATE BOARD FOR EDUCATOR CERTIFICATION
CHAPTER 249 - DISCIPLINARY PROCEEDINGS, SANCTIONS, AND CONTESTED CASES
SUBCHAPTER C - PREHEARING MATTERS
SECTION/RULE §249.23 - Representation of Parties
Chapter Review Date 06/06/2023

(a) Representatives of parties shall notify the State Office of Administrative Hearings (SOAH) and other parties of the representation.(b) At an informal conference offered pursuant to the Texas Government Code, Chapter 2001, a person may be represented by a person who is not an attorney.(c) Parties in contested cases before the SOAH may represent themselves or be represented by an attorney licensed to practice law in the State of Texas.

Source Note: The provisions of this §249.23 adopted to be effective March 31, 1999, 24 TexReg 2304; amended to be effective December 16, 2007, 32 TexReg 9112.
